Output 32492e2a7c97ffb917ed1e8808c027b13e0efbf3eb358e8ef960608654270a0a:0

value
17787261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ab6730277619e3fd54bba89b38b48373756550b OP_EQUAL
address
3HFfMx96JU8ovCZdZaudWCKre8KaE35VTk
transaction
32492e2a7c97ffb917ed1e8808c027b13e0efbf3eb358e8ef960608654270a0a
spent
true